This Week’s Koan

Gateless Gate #17

“National Teacher’s Three Calls”

The National Teacher called his attendant three times, and three times the attendant responded.

The National Teacher said, “I long feared that I was betraying you, but really it was you who were betraying me.”

Mumon’s Verse

He carried and iron yoke with no hole
 And left a curse to trouble his descendants.
If you want to hold up the gate and the doors,
You must climb a mountain of swords with bare feet.
